We work with horses and other animals to help children with autism, attachment disorders, social or communication difficulties, anxiety and other emotional issues.We use observation of horse behaviour to learn about interaction styles and explore feelings.
Other activities with the horses encourages development of problem-solving skills, improved communication, management of emotions and behaviour, increase in self confidence and self esteem.
We support children with challenging behaviour who are unable to access mainstream education as well as supporting children in their education placements. We can use makaton and PECS to support in a low sensory enviroment.
We now also provide child counselling and equine facilitated therapy for children and young people with mental health issues.
